<?php

//****************//
//  modSolicitudesConsultar.php//
//****************//
header('Content-Type: application/json');
include "../class/clsTramiteAsignatura.php";
$objConsulta = new clsTramiteAsignatura();
$strAcent = 'ÀÁÂÃÄÅÈÉÊËÌÍÎÏÒÓÔÕÖÙÚÛÜàáâãäåèéêëìíîïòóôõöùúûü';
$strNuevo = 'AAAAAAEEEEIIIIOOOOOUUUUaaaaaaeeeeiiiiooooouuuu';
// Quitar caracteres con acentos
$nombres = strtr(utf8_decode($_POST['nombres']), utf8_decode($strAcent), $strNuevo);
$paterno = strtr(utf8_decode($_POST['paterno']), utf8_decode($strAcent), $strNuevo);
$materno = strtr(utf8_decode($_POST['materno']), utf8_decode($strAcent), $strNuevo);
// setters para configurar el filtro de la consulta
$objConsulta->setidDependencia($_POST['pIdDependencia']);
if ($_POST['pIdProgramaEducativo'] != '') {
    $objConsulta->setidProgramaEducativoVersion($_POST['pIdProgramaEducativo']);
}
if ($nombres != '') {
    $objConsulta->setnombres($nombres);
}
if ($paterno != '') {
    $objConsulta->setpaterno($paterno);
}
if ($materno != '') {
    $objConsulta->setmaterno($materno);
}
if ($_POST['numeroCuenta'] != '') {
    $objConsulta->setnumeroCuenta($_POST['numeroCuenta']);
}
<?php

//****************//
//  modSolicitudesEstadoModificar.php//
//****************//
include "../class/clsTramiteAsignatura.php";
$objTramite = new clsTramiteAsignatura();
$arrListaTramites = explode('@', $_REQUEST['listaTramites']);
$arrListaErrores = array();
$i = 0;
foreach ($arrListaTramites as $tramiteId) {
    if ($tramiteId == '') {
        continue;
    }
    $objTramite->setidTramite($tramiteId);
    $objTramite->setestado($_REQUEST['estadoId']);
    $objTramite->setobservaciones($_REQUEST['observaciones']);
    $objTramite->setusuarioRealizo($_SESSION['VS_Usuario']);
    $arrSalida = $objTramite->ecmDatosTramiteActualizar();
    if ($arrSalida['noError'] > 0) {
        $arrListaErrores[$i]['noError'] = $arrSalida['noError'];
        $arrListaErrores[$i]['msj'] = $arrSalida['mensaje'];
        $i++;
    }
}
echo json_encode($arrListaErrores);
<?php

//****************//
//  modSolicitudesConsultar.php//
//****************//
header('Content-Type: application/json');
include "../class/clsTramiteAsignatura.php";
$objConsulta = new clsTramiteAsignatura();
$objConsulta->setidDependencia($_REQUEST['pIdDependencia']);
$objConsulta->setidProgramaEducativoVersion($_REQUEST['pIdProgramaEducativo']);
$objConsulta->setcicloEscolar($_REQUEST['pCicloEscolar']);
$objConsulta->setidEstado($_REQUEST['pIdEstado']);
$objConsulta->setOrdenQuery("materia");
ob_clean();
echo $objConsulta->getDatosJson(false);
<?php

//****************//
//  modListaAlumnosTramiteAsignaturaConsultar.php//
//****************//
include "../class/clsTramiteAsignatura.php";
header('Content-Type: application/json');
$objConsulta = new clsTramiteAsignatura();
// setters para configurar el filtro de la consulta
$objConsulta->setidDependencia($_POST['pIdDependencia']);
$objConsulta->setidProgramaEducativoVersion($_POST['pIdProgramaEducativo']);
$objConsulta->setcicloEscolar($_POST['pCicloEscolar']);
$objConsulta->setidMateria($_POST['pIdMateria']);
$objConsulta->setOrdenQuery("nombreCompleto");
echo $objConsulta->getDatosJson(false);